Default How do I prevent spell chk from chkg headers/footers in word2003

Using Word 2003. While spell checking documents, would like to skip the
headers/footers of the document. Work in transcription and the information
in headers/footers changes constantly, most of it names that are
unrecognizable to spell check. Just need to turn "off" the spell check for
headers/footers. Cannot find information on it.
